MEMBERSHIP CATEGORIES & DUES A full year renewal rate is $299 for Executive, $195 for Regular, $85 for Entry and $35 for Student membership. Your renewal rate may be lower if you joined after January in your first year because WICT credits you for the months you missed. We offer a two-year membership option for Executive and Regular level memberships.LYNN MCMAHON

Since 2003, WICT WICT's PAR Initiative (Pay Equity, Advancement Opportunities, and Resources for Work/Life Integration) has measured the status of women in the cable industry. Combined with a comprehensive advocacy program, the PAR Initiative helps companies set goals, institutionalize practices, measure progress and achieve results.
